js问题,如何实现?
当点击文字后,下拉菜单的值变成被点击的文字<span onClick="setText(this.innerHTML)">被点击文字</span>
function setText(text){
parent.document.getElementById("mytext").innerHTML += '<option value="">' + text + '</option>';//这是我的方法,不能实现
}
<select name="mytext" id="mytext">
<option value="刚传送过来的字">刚传送过来的字</option>
<option value="上一次点击传送过来的字">上一次点击传送过来的字</option>
<option value="上上一次点击传送过来的字">上上一次点击传送过来的字</option>
下面以此类推
</select>
追问:可以实现,但怎样才能实现传递过去的数据默认显示?